A Ceylonese ebonised and caned armchair, 19th century
the rectangular caned back with shell-and-lotus-carved top-rail, caned seat, foliate-carved arm supports, moulded seat rails, on ring-turned and lobed legs, brass cappings and castors
Provenance
Sold: The Elizabeth Mark Collection. Sotheby's, Johannesburg, 29 April 1985, lot 144
